(a)
Pilot program established— The Secretary of Veterans Affairs shall establish a pilot program to award grants to health care entities to lease, purchase, or build health care facilities for female patients to provide hospital care and medical services to qualified female veterans.
(b)
Duration of pilot program— The pilot program shall terminate three years after the date of the enactment of this Act.
(c)
Application— To be selected to receive a grant under the pilot program, a health care entity shall submit to the Secretary an application at such time, in such manner, and containing such information as the Secretary may require.
(d)
Nature of facilities leased, purchased, or built through use of pilot program grant funds— For purposes of providing hospital care and medical services to qualified female veterans, a health care facility leased, purchased, or built under the pilot program shall be deemed to be—
(1)
an entity specified in section 101(a)(1)(B) of the Veterans Access, Choice, and Accountability Act of 2014 (
38 U.S.C. 1701 note); or
(2)
if the authority to carry out the program established under section 101 of such Act is terminated, an entity otherwise authorized to provide hospital care and medical services pursuant to an agreement entered into by the Secretary.
(e)
Report— Not later than three years after the date of the enactment of this Act, the Secretary of Veterans Affairs shall submit a report to Congress that includes the following:
(1)
The number of grants awarded under the pilot program.
(2)
The amount of each grant awarded under the pilot program.
(3)
A list of the health care entities awarded grants under the pilot program.
(4)
An assessment of the pilot program.
(5)
A recommendation as to whether the duration of the pilot program should be extended.

(g)
Authorization of appropriations— There is authorized to be appropriated to the Secretary of Veterans Affairs $10,000,000 for fiscal year 2017 to carry out the pilot program.
